About

Since 2017, Manuel Baca has been deeply involved in managing and improving the family farm, Finca Pacpa, in the Amazonas region of Peru. Coffee production is ingrained into this family's history, a fourth generation farmer himself and many of his relatives are coffee producers in their own right, so it comes as no surprise that this coffee is simply excellent. Tasting notes: Floral, Bright, Expressive. Region: Amazonas, Peru. Farm: Finca Pacpa. Producer: Manuel Baca. Variety: Gesha. Process: Washed. Altitude: 1850m.
